Hegemonic Masculinity
Refers to cultural norms that promote the dominant social position of men, and the subordinate social position of women.
Triracial Stratification
A sociological model that describes the division of society into three racial groups, often hierarchical, influencing socioeconomic status and opportunities.
White Power
A racist ideology centered on the belief in the superiority of white people and advocating for the dominance of the white race.
Oppositional Identity
An identity formed in opposition to the values and norms of mainstream culture.
